Re-evaluate our default-supplied SSUAOs. #1914

Open
opened 3 months ago by Moonchild · 1 comments
Owner

A number of our SSUAOs are old, and may no longer be relevant.
Less is more; I'd rather have as few of these as possible.
With the platform now having more web compatibility we may be able to get rid of quite a few of these or at least update version numbers.

This will take time and input from people actually on the sites we have overrides for. Help appreciated!

A number of our SSUAOs are old, and may no longer be relevant. Less is more; I'd rather have as few of these as possible. With the platform now having more web compatibility we may be able to get rid of quite a few of these or at least update version numbers. This will take time and input from people actually on the sites we have overrides for. Help appreciated!
Moonchild added the
Code Cleanup
Help Wanted
SSUAO
labels 3 months ago
disil07 commented 7 days ago

I evaluated some of general.useragent.override that is used. Here's the result:

  1. Well, despite being Out-of-topic, I think that canva.com should have Mozilla/5.0 (%OS_SLICE% rv:68.0) Gecko/20100101 Firefox/68.0 otherwise it will nag you to use "supported browser".
  2. I don't think we need the general.useragent.override.spotify.com because account management works fine without that override. Also spotify uses drm, so it's useless.
  3. general.useragent.override.twitter.com is not needed anymore because it works just fine without it
  4. general.useragent.override.firefox.com is not needed
I evaluated some of general.useragent.override that is used. Here's the result: 1. Well, despite being Out-of-topic, I think that `canva.com` should have `Mozilla/5.0 (%OS_SLICE% rv:68.0) Gecko/20100101 Firefox/68.0` otherwise it will nag you to use "supported browser". 2. I don't think we need the `general.useragent.override.spotify.com` because account management works fine without that override. Also spotify uses drm, so it's useless. 3. `general.useragent.override.twitter.com` is not needed anymore because it works just fine without it 4. `general.useragent.override.firefox.com` is not needed
Sign in to join this conversation.
No Milestone
No Assignees
2 Participants
Notifications
Due Date
The due date is invalid or out of range. Please use the format 'yyyy-mm-dd'.

No due date set.

Dependencies

No dependencies set.

Reference: MoonchildProductions/Pale-Moon#1914
Loading…
There is no content yet.